Index: modules/awt/src/main/native/linuxfont/unix/include/org_apache_harmony_awt_gl_font_LinuxNativeFont.h =================================================================== --- modules/awt/src/main/native/linuxfont/unix/include/org_apache_harmony_awt_gl_font_LinuxNativeFont.h (revision 502537) +++ modules/awt/src/main/native/linuxfont/unix/include/org_apache_harmony_awt_gl_font_LinuxNativeFont.h (working copy) @@ -241,6 +241,28 @@ Java_org_apache_harmony_awt_gl_font_LinuxNativeFont_getExtraMetricsNative(JNIEnv *, jclass, jlong, jint, jint); +/* + * Method: org.apache.harmony.awt.gl.font.LinuxNativeFont.NativeFreeGlyphBitmap(J)V + */ +JNIEXPORT void JNICALL +Java_org_apache_harmony_awt_gl_font_LinuxNativeFont_NativeFreeGlyphBitmap(JNIEnv *, jclass, jlong); + +/* + * Class: org_apache_harmony_awt_gl_font_LinuxNativeFont + * Method: getPointsFromFTVector + * Signature: (JI)[F + */ +JNIEXPORT jfloatArray JNICALL Java_org_apache_harmony_awt_gl_font_LinuxNativeFont_getPointsFromFTVector + (JNIEnv *, jclass, jlong, jint); + +/* + * Class: org_apache_harmony_awt_gl_font_LinuxNativeFont + * Method: freeGlyphOutline + * Signature: (J)V + */ +JNIEXPORT void JNICALL Java_org_apache_harmony_awt_gl_font_LinuxNativeFont_freeGlyphOutline + (JNIEnv *, jclass, jlong); + #ifdef __cplusplus } #endif Index: modules/awt/src/main/native/linuxfont/unix/liblinuxfont.exp =================================================================== --- modules/awt/src/main/native/linuxfont/unix/liblinuxfont.exp (revision 502537) +++ modules/awt/src/main/native/linuxfont/unix/liblinuxfont.exp (working copy) @@ -26,5 +26,8 @@ Java_org_apache_harmony_awt_gl_font_LinuxNativeFont_RemoveFontResource; Java_org_apache_harmony_awt_gl_font_LinuxNativeFont_XftDrawSetClipRectangles; Java_org_apache_harmony_awt_gl_font_LinuxNativeFont_xftDrawSetSubwindowModeNative; + Java_org_apache_harmony_awt_gl_font_LinuxNativeFont_NativeFreeGlyphBitmap; + Java_org_apache_harmony_awt_gl_font_LinuxNativeFont_getPointsFromFTVector; + Java_org_apache_harmony_awt_gl_font_LinuxNativeFont_freeGlyphOutline; local : *; };